WebZhu et al. identify tissue-resident macrophages of embryonic origin as a source of tumor-associated macrophages in p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ma. These cells expand through in situ proliferation during tumor progression and demonstrate a unique pro-fibrotic transcriptional profile distinct from that of their monocyte-derived counterparts. theto meaning in sepedi

WebJul 21, 2005 · Macrophage precursors are present in the fetal pancreas at E12.5. To examine the presence of macrophage precursors before any labeling of mature macrophage markers was detected in the fetal pancreas, pancreatic buds along with the stomach and duodenal loops were excised at E12.5 and cultured for 5 days with or without M-CSF. WebPancreas TRMs cluster with resident macrophages throughout the exocrine areas; TRM effector functions are enhanced by macrophage-derived co-stimulation and attenuated by the PD-1/PD-L1 pathways. Conversely, in samples from chronic pancreatitis, TRMs exhibit reduced PD-1 expression and reduced interactions with macrophages.
